Exciting Cast Confirmation for ‘My Precious Star’
On March 24, the production team officially confirmed that renowned actors Uhm Jung Hwa and Song Seung Heon will reunite for the highly anticipated drama “My Precious Star”. This project is set to captivate audiences as it explores the intricacies of the entertainment industry, blending elements of romance and comedy. Joining the lead cast are Lee El and Oh Dae Hwan, both promising to elevate the series with their respective roles.
A Unique and Engaging Narrative
“My Precious Star” follows the story of Im Se Ra, a top actress who faces an unforeseen accident, leading to a 25-year hiatus from her illustrious career. Uhm Jung Hwa takes on the role of Bong Cheong Ja, a woman who lost her memories but is revealed to be the legendary Im Se Ra, while Song Seung Heon portrays Dokgo Chul, a former top detective who finds himself intertwined with her life as her manager. This gripping narrative details Cheong Ja’s emotional journey to recover her identity and reclaim her position in the industry.
High Hopes for a Memorable On-Screen Reunion
Fans are particularly excited about Uhm Jung Hwa and Song Seung Heon’s reunion, a decade after their collaboration in the film “Wonderful Nightmare”. Their on-screen chemistry is highly anticipated, particularly with Hwan and El’s powerful supporting performances adding depth to the story. Additionally, with director Choi Young Hoon and writer Park Ji Ha, known for their previous successful projects, expectations for “My Precious Star” are soaring.
Filming for this much-awaited drama has officially commenced, with a premiere slated for the latter half of 2025. Audiences can look forward to witnessing a compelling tale of resilience, fame, and redemption.
